Documentation burden is now a leading driver of clinician burnout across roles. Research published in the Annals of Internal Medicine found that physicians spend nearly two hours on EHR and documentation work for every one hour of direct patient care, and an AHRQ scoping review documents the same burden across nurse practitioners, physician assistants, registered nurses, clinical psychologists, social workers, occupational and physical therapists, dietitians, and speech pathologists. Voice-driven documentation is one of the few interventions that compresses this overhead without compromising note quality.

VoiceboxMD vs Dragon Medical: side-by-side

Dragon Medical (Nuance / Microsoft) is the legacy incumbent in clinical dictation. Since the 2022 Microsoft acquisition of Nuance, Dragon Medical One has consolidated as a cloud-only product on Azure, with enterprise procurement cycles and pricing oriented toward hospital systems. VoiceboxMD is the modern alternative, same core promise of accurate medical speech-to-text, rebuilt for cloud workflows, EHR-agnostic deployment, and pricing that fits an independent practice or solo clinician rather than only a hospital system.

How is medical dictation different from an AI medical scribe?

Medical dictation transcribes exactly what the clinician says, word for word, into the active text field. The clinician controls every word in the chart. An AI medical scribe listens to the entire patient encounter and generates structured clinical notes, SOAP, H&P, billing codes, automatically.
